Prior to the co-operation with horak.attorneys at law partnership in 2016, Dr. Müller was a European and German patent attorney trainee at a national and international operating law firm for intellectual property in Jülich. During this time she studied "Law for Patent Attorneys" at Hagen University and passed the European pre-qualifying examination. Prior to her legal career Dr. Müller studied Biology at the Georg-August-University of Göttingen focusing on the fields of biochemistry, chemistry and molecular biology. Working as a research assistant at the Institute for Clinical Biochemistry in Hanover she obtained her doctoral degree (Doctor rerum naturalium) with summa cum laude in 2012.
